CVE-2026-0974 is a high-severity vulnerability rated 8.8/10 on the CVSS scale. The Orderable – WordPress Restaurant Online Ordering System and Food Ordering Plugin pl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ized plugin installation due to a missing capability check on the 'install_plugin' function in all versions up to, and including, 1.20.0.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to install arbitrary plugins, which can lead to Remote Code Execution.. EPSS estimates a 0.60%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
